Output 3ebc3363ded4019136887ce1a950a15d3a17b6a26e71cefb799b02c84ebef248:61

value
3188646
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 38e12b87b233e83260ec7a9e80f83a05474da3b655bf3d7f6394149dcc656c88
address
bc1p8rsjhpajx05ryc8v020gp7p6q4r5mgak2kln6lmrjs2fmnr9djyqnvuule
transaction
3ebc3363ded4019136887ce1a950a15d3a17b6a26e71cefb799b02c84ebef248
spent
true